According to our latest research, the global community analytics platform market size reached USD 2.8 billion in 2024, with a robust growth trajectory driven by the rising demand for actionable insights from online communities. The market is expected to expand at a CAGR of 17.2% from 2025 to 2033, reaching an estimated USD 12.9 billion by 2033. This growth is propelled by the increasing integration of artificial intelligence, machine learning, and advanced data analytics in community management tools, which enable organizations to better understand user behavior, enhance engagement, and optimize business strategies.
One of the primary growth factors for the community analytics platform market is the exponential rise in digital communities and social media interactions across industries. As organizations increasingly rely on digital platforms to foster brand loyalty, provide customer support, and build engaged user bases, the need for robust analytics solutions becomes paramount. Community analytics platforms empower businesses to extract valuable insights from user-generated content, sentiment, and engagement patterns, enabling data-driven decision-making. The proliferation of online forums, brand communities, and social networking groups has created a goldmine of data, which, when properly analyzed, can significantly enhance customer engagement and drive business growth.
Another significant driver is the rapid adoption of cloud-based analytics solutions. Cloud deployment offers scalability, flexibility, and cost-effectiveness, making it an attractive choice for organizations of all sizes. The shift towards cloud-based community analytics platforms is further accelerated by the need for real-time data processing and remote accessibility, especially in the post-pandemic era where remote work and virtual communities have become the norm. Cloud solutions also facilitate seamless integration with other business applications, enabling organizations to create a unified data ecosystem that enhances operational efficiency and strategic planning.
Furthermore, advancements in artificial intelligence and machine learning are transforming the landscape of community analytics. AI-powered platforms can automate sentiment analysis, content moderation, and predictive analytics, providing deeper insights into community dynamics and user behavior. These technologies enable organizations to identify emerging trends, detect potential issues, and personalize interactions at scale. As a result, businesses are increasingly investing in AI-driven community analytics solutions to stay ahead of the competition, improve customer satisfaction, and foster long-term loyalty.
From a regional perspective, North America continues to dominate the community analytics platform market, accounting for the largest revenue share in 2024. This dominance is attributed to the high adoption rate of advanced analytics technologies, the presence of major market players, and the strong digital infrastructure in the region. However, Asia Pacific is emerging as the fastest-growing market, fueled by rapid digitalization, increasing internet penetration, and the growing popularity of online communities in countries like China, India, and Japan. Europe also holds a significant market share, driven by the rising focus on customer experience and regulatory requirements for data-driven decision-making.

As per our latest research, the global real-time analytics platform market size reached USD 17.8 billion in 2024, reflecting strong enterprise demand for immediate data-driven insights. The market is expected to expand at a robust CAGR of 28.2% from 2025 to 2033, reaching approximately USD 157.1 billion by 2033. This remarkable growth is fueled by the increasing adoption of big data analytics, the proliferation of IoT devices, and the critical need for instant decision-making across industries.
One of the primary growth drivers for the real-time analytics platform market is the surging volume and velocity of data generated by modern digital ecosystems. Enterprises are leveraging real-time analytics to process and analyze streaming data from various sources, including IoT sensors, social media, transactional systems, and more. This capability enables organizations to derive actionable insights within milliseconds, which is invaluable for use cases such as fraud detection, predictive maintenance, and customer experience management. The shift toward data-driven decision-making, coupled with the increasing complexity of business operations, is compelling organizations to invest in robust real-time analytics solutions that can handle large-scale, high-frequency data streams efficiently.
Another significant factor propelling market growth is the rapid digital transformation initiatives undertaken by businesses across sectors. The integration of AI and machine learning with real-time analytics platforms has further enhanced their capabilities, allowing for more accurate predictions and automated responses to emerging trends or anomalies. Industries such as BFSI, healthcare, retail, and telecommunications are at the forefront of this transformation, utilizing real-time analytics to optimize operations, mitigate risks, and deliver personalized services. Furthermore, the growing adoption of cloud computing has made real-time analytics platforms more accessible and scalable, enabling even small and medium enterprises to harness their benefits without heavy upfront investments in infrastructure.
The increasing focus on customer-centric business models is also a vital growth catalyst for the real-time analytics platform market. Organizations are leveraging real-time analytics to gain a 360-degree view of customer behavior, preferences, and sentiment, allowing them to tailor offerings and enhance engagement. Real-time insights are crucial for delivering seamless omnichannel experiences, proactive customer support, and targeted marketing campaigns. Moreover, the evolving regulatory landscape, particularly in sectors like finance and healthcare, is driving the adoption of analytics platforms that can provide real-time compliance monitoring and reporting capabilities, thereby reducing operational risks.
From a regional perspective, North America continues to dominate the real-time analytics platform market, accounting for the largest share in 2024, followed closely by Europe and Asia Pacific. The United States, in particular, is a major contributor, driven by the presence of leading technology providers, early adoption of advanced analytics solutions, and a strong focus on innovation. Asia Pacific is expected to witness the fastest growth during the forecast period, supported by rapid digitalization, increasing investments in smart infrastructure, and the expansion of the e-commerce and telecommunications sectors. Meanwhile, Latin America and the Middle East & Africa are gradually emerging as promising markets, fueled by growing awareness and government initiatives to promote digital transformation.

According to our latest research, the global Data Loss Analytics Platform market size reached USD 3.21 billion in 2024, reflecting a robust expansion driven by the increasing frequency and sophistication of cyber threats worldwide. The market is expected to grow at a CAGR of 18.7% from 2025 to 2033, with a forecasted value of USD 17.17 billion by 2033. The principal growth factor fueling this surge is the escalating need for advanced analytics solutions to proactively detect, analyze, and mitigate data loss incidents across enterprises of all sizes and industries, as organizations prioritize data integrity and regulatory compliance in an ever-evolving digital landscape.
One of the primary growth drivers for the Data Loss Analytics Platform market is the exponential increase in data generation and storage across diverse sectors. Organizations are now managing vast amounts of sensitive information, including customer data, intellectual property, and financial records, which makes them prime targets for cybercriminals. The proliferation of cloud-based services, remote work environments, and mobile devices has further expanded the potential attack surface, necessitating robust analytics platforms that can provide real-time monitoring, anomaly detection, and automated incident response. As a result, enterprises are investing significantly in data loss analytics to safeguard their critical assets and maintain business continuity, propelling market growth at an accelerated pace.
Another significant factor contributing to market expansion is the tightening of global data protection regulations and compliance requirements. Legislation such as the General Data Protection Regulation (GDPR) in Europe, the California Consumer Privacy Act (CCPA), and other country-specific mandates have made it imperative for organizations to implement comprehensive data loss prevention and analytics solutions. These regulations not only demand stringent reporting and response mechanisms for data breaches but also impose hefty penalties for non-compliance. Consequently, businesses across sectors are turning to advanced analytics platforms that deliver deep visibility into data flows, ensure compliance, and facilitate rapid forensics in the event of an incident, thereby driving sustained demand in the market.
Technological advancements in artificial intelligence (AI) and machine learning (ML) are further accelerating the adoption of Data Loss Analytics Platforms. Modern solutions leverage AI-driven algorithms to identify complex patterns indicative of data exfiltration or insider threats, which traditional security tools often miss. The integration of predictive analytics, behavioral analysis, and automated remediation capabilities enables organizations to stay ahead of evolving threats. This technological evolution, coupled with the growing awareness of the financial and reputational risks associated with data loss, is compelling enterprises to upgrade their security infrastructure with next-generation analytics platforms, thereby fueling market growth.
From a regional perspective, North America continues to dominate the Data Loss Analytics Platform market, accounting for the largest revenue share in 2024. The presence of major technology players, early adoption of advanced security solutions, and a highly regulated business environment contribute to the region’s leadership. Europe follows closely, driven by stringent data protection laws and increasing investments in cybersecurity infrastructure. Meanwhile, the Asia Pacific region is witnessing the fastest growth, attributed to rapid digitization, expanding IT ecosystems, and rising awareness of cyber risks among enterprises. Emerging economies in Latin America and the Middle East & Africa are also gradually increasing their adoption of data loss analytics platforms, supported by digital transformation initiatives and a growing focus on information security.

According to our latest research, the global SPI‑AOI Data Analytics Platform market size is valued at USD 1.42 billion in 2024, with a robust compound annual growth rate (CAGR) of 13.7% projected from 2025 to 2033. By the end of 2033, the market is expected to reach USD 4.14 billion. This remarkable growth trajectory is driven by rapid advancements in electronics manufacturing and the increasing integration of data analytics with inspection technologies, which are transforming quality assurance processes across multiple industries. As per our latest research, the demand for intelligent and automated inspection solutions is at an all-time high, catalyzing market expansion and technological innovation in the SPI‑AOI Data Analytics Platform sector.
One of the primary growth factors for the SPI‑AOI Data Analytics Platform market is the accelerating adoption of Industry 4.0 practices across global manufacturing landscapes. The convergence of surface mount technology (SMT) with advanced analytics enables manufacturers to achieve higher yield rates, minimize defects, and optimize production lines in real-time. As electronics miniaturization and complexity increase, the need for precise solder paste inspection (SPI) and automated optical inspection (AOI) becomes critical. Data analytics platforms that aggregate and analyze inspection data empower manufacturers with actionable insights, allowing them to proactively address process inefficiencies and improve overall product quality. This trend is particularly pronounced in sectors such as automotive, consumer electronics, and semiconductors, where stringent quality standards and high-volume production necessitate advanced inspection and analytics solutions.
Another significant growth driver is the integration of artificial intelligence (AI) and machine learning (ML) algorithms within SPI‑AOI Data Analytics Platforms. These technologies enhance defect detection accuracy, reduce false positives, and enable predictive maintenance by identifying patterns and anomalies in inspection data. The shift towards cloud-based analytics platforms further amplifies these benefits by providing scalable, centralized data repositories and facilitating seamless collaboration across geographically dispersed manufacturing sites. As a result, organizations are increasingly investing in comprehensive data analytics ecosystems that not only support real-time decision-making but also ensure traceability and regulatory compliance. The continuous evolution of AI and ML capabilities is expected to further expand the scope and impact of SPI‑AOI Data Analytics Platforms in the coming years.
Additionally, the growing emphasis on cost reduction and process optimization in manufacturing environments is fueling the adoption of SPI‑AOI Data Analytics Platforms. By leveraging advanced analytics, manufacturers can identify root causes of defects, implement targeted process improvements, and reduce material wastage. The ability to monitor and analyze inspection data across multiple production lines and facilities enables companies to benchmark performance, standardize best practices, and drive continuous improvement initiatives. Furthermore, the increasing availability of customizable analytics solutions allows organizations of all sizes, from small and medium enterprises (SMEs) to large enterprises, to tailor their inspection and analytics strategies to specific operational requirements and business objectives. This democratization of advanced analytics is a key enabler of market growth, particularly in emerging economies where manufacturing sectors are rapidly modernizing.
From a regional perspective, Asia Pacific remains the dominant force in the SPI‑AOI Data Analytics Platform market, accounting for the largest share in 2024. This leadership is underpinned by the region’s robust electronics manufacturing ecosystem, particularly in countries such as China, Japan, South Korea, and Taiwan. The proliferation of high-tech manufacturing facilities, coupled with significant investments in automation and smart factory initiatives, has positioned Asia Pacific as a hub for innovation and adoption of advanced inspection and analytics technologies. North America and Europe also represent substantial markets, driven by the presence of leading technology companies and a strong focus on quality assurance and regulatory compliance in industries such as automotive, healthcare, and aerospace. According to our latest research, the global RAN Data Analytics Platform market size stood at USD 1.27 billion in 2024, reflecting the rapid adoption of advanced analytics solutions in the telecommunications sector. The market is poised to grow at a robust CAGR of 32.8% from 2025 to 2033, reaching a projected value of USD 15.13 billion by 2033. This remarkable growth trajectory is primarily driven by the escalating demand for real-time network optimization, the proliferation of 5G deployments, and the increasing necessity to manage and analyze massive volumes of radio access network (RAN) data for enhanced operational efficiency and customer experience.
One of the most significant growth factors propelling the RAN Data Analytics Platform market is the exponential surge in mobile data traffic worldwide, driven by the widespread adoption of smartphones, IoT devices, and high-bandwidth applications such as streaming video and online gaming. As telecom operators strive to deliver seamless connectivity and superior user experiences, they are increasingly investing in intelligent analytics platforms capable of providing actionable insights into network performance, congestion hotspots, and user behavior. These platforms enable operators to proactively address network issues, optimize resource allocation, and support dynamic network slicing, all of which are critical for the successful rollout and monetization of 5G services. The ability of RAN data analytics platforms to deliver granular, real-time insights is becoming indispensable as networks grow in complexity and scale.
Another key growth driver is the strategic shift towards automation and predictive maintenance within telecom networks. Traditional reactive maintenance approaches are no longer sufficient in the context of dense, heterogeneous 5G RAN environments. RAN data analytics platforms empower operators to move towards predictive and preventive maintenance by leveraging machine learning algorithms and historical data to forecast potential network failures, performance degradation, or equipment anomalies. This transition not only minimizes unplanned downtime and operational costs but also enhances network reliability and customer satisfaction. The integration of artificial intelligence (AI) and machine learning (ML) into RAN analytics platforms is accelerating this trend, enabling telecom operators to automate complex decision-making processes and unlock new levels of efficiency.
The growing emphasis on energy efficiency and sustainability in telecommunications is also fueling the adoption of RAN data analytics platforms. With energy consumption representing a significant portion of network operating expenses, especially in large-scale 5G deployments, operators are leveraging advanced analytics to monitor and optimize energy usage across their RAN infrastructure. These platforms provide insights into energy consumption patterns, identify inefficiencies, and suggest actionable measures to reduce power usage without compromising network performance. As regulatory pressures and corporate sustainability goals intensify, the role of RAN data analytics in supporting green network initiatives is expected to become even more pronounced, further driving market expansion.
The advent of Cloud RAN technology is reshaping the telecommunications landscape by offering a more flexible and scalable approach to managing radio access networks. Cloud RAN, or Cloud Radio Access Network, enables operators to centralize and virtualize their RAN functions, allowing for more efficient resource utilization and easier network management. This technology is particularly beneficial in the context of 5G deployments, where the need for rapid scalability and adaptability is paramount. By leveraging cloud computing capabilities, operators can dynamically allocate network resources based on real-time demand, reducing operational costs and enhancing service delivery. The integration of Cloud RAN with advanced analytics platforms further amplifies its potential, enabling telecom operators to harness real-time insights for optimized network performance and improved user experiences.

According to our latest research, the global prescriptive analytics platform market size is valued at USD 9.8 billion in 2024, demonstrating robust expansion propelled by the surging adoption of advanced analytics across industries. The market is expected to grow at a CAGR of 24.1% from 2025 to 2033, reaching a forecasted value of USD 79.5 billion by 2033. This impressive growth trajectory is primarily driven by the increasing need for real-time decision-making, optimization of business operations, and the integration of artificial intelligence and machine learning technologies within analytics platforms. As per the latest research, organizations are increasingly leveraging prescriptive analytics to gain actionable insights, drive efficiency, and maintain competitive advantage in rapidly evolving markets.
One of the most significant growth factors for the prescriptive analytics platform market is the escalating volume and complexity of data generated by businesses today. Enterprises are experiencing a data deluge from a multitude of sources including IoT devices, social media, transactional systems, and customer interactions. This proliferation of data necessitates sophisticated analytics solutions that not only describe and predict outcomes but also prescribe optimal actions. Prescriptive analytics platforms, equipped with advanced algorithms and scenario analysis capabilities, empower organizations to move beyond descriptive and predictive analytics. They enable businesses to identify the best course of action in complex scenarios, automate decision-making, and respond dynamically to market changes, which is becoming indispensable in sectors such as supply chain, finance, and healthcare.
Another pivotal driver is the growing integration of artificial intelligence (AI) and machine learning (ML) within prescriptive analytics platforms. These technologies enhance the analytical power of platforms by enabling continuous learning, adaptation, and optimization based on real-time data. AI-driven prescriptive analytics can process vast datasets, recognize intricate patterns, and recommend actionable strategies that maximize business objectives such as revenue growth, cost reduction, and risk mitigation. The ability to simulate various scenarios through digital twins and advanced simulation models further amplifies the value proposition of these platforms. This technological synergy is attracting significant investments from both large enterprises and SMEs, who are eager to harness the benefits of data-driven decision-making.
The increasing emphasis on digital transformation across industries is also fueling the demand for prescriptive analytics platforms. Organizations are under mounting pressure to modernize their operations, enhance customer experiences, and streamline processes. Prescriptive analytics platforms are at the core of these transformation efforts, enabling data-driven strategies that align with business goals. Regulatory compliance requirements, especially in highly regulated sectors such as BFSI and healthcare, further necessitate robust analytics solutions that can provide transparent, auditable, and optimized recommendations. As a result, vendors are continuously enhancing their platforms with features such as explainable AI, robust data governance, and seamless integration with existing enterprise systems.
From a regional perspective, North America currently dominates the prescriptive analytics platform market, accounting for over 40% of global revenue in 2024. This leadership is attributed to the region’s advanced technological infrastructure, high digital maturity among enterprises, and significant investments in AI and analytics. However, Asia Pacific is emerging as the fastest-growing region, with a projected CAGR exceeding 27% through 2033. The rapid adoption of digital technologies, burgeoning startup ecosystem, and increasing focus on operational efficiency in countries such as China, India, and Japan are propelling market growth in this region. Europe and Latin America are also witnessing steady adoption, particularly in sectors such as manufacturing, retail, and financial services.
